Abstract
The present invention relates to a system for operating an integrated point service using a card point, comprising: a user terminal (110) for a user to use an integrated point service; A card issuer server 120 for generating a card point according to a card usage of a user; An integrated point service server 130 for paying a corresponding item on the basis of an integrated point when a user requests to purchase an item through the integrated point exchanged from the card point using the user terminal 110; When the user requests exchange of the card point to the integration point by using the user terminal 110, the card point information of the user is received from the card company server 120 and the user's card point is exchanged with the integration point in accordance with the exchange ratio, And provides the integrated point information to the user. In response to the item purchase request through the integration point to the integrated point service server 130 by the user using the user terminal 110, the integrated point service server 130 to the integrated point service server 130 in response to the user's request for the integrated point information, and also reflects the used integrated points of the user according to the progress of the payment, Between the card issuer server 120 and the integrated point service server 130 And an integration point management server 140 that performs settlement according to the settlement rate (exchange rate) of the card company and the integrated point service franchisee respectively.

The present invention relates to a system and method for operating an integrated point service utilizing a card point, and more particularly, to a system and method for operating an integrated point service using a card point, in which a user can purchase various types of items such as goods and services And an integrated point service operating system and method using the card point.
Credit card companies use credit cards as a currency in cooperation with various companies for marketing purposes, in the form of numerical value of mileage generated by the use of credit cards. The credit card companies estimate the amount of usage based on past usage data among the credit card points and set the allowance. Points are paid for using the cost, but generally receive less than the list price. Also, if you want to purchase a product through points, you are selling at a higher price than when you buy it with cash.
Recently, the Financial Services Commission (FSC) has implemented a policy to lower the minimum unit amount of card points to 1 won. In addition, the aging of card points has been merged into 5 years, and there is a movement demanding various ways of promoting various points consumption accordingly. Card companies are also implementing policies to promote the use of points. A credit card company will eliminate the statute of limitations, and B card company is considering a policy to refund a cash point if it accumulates more than a certain point.
This situation related to card points is a new point of view for card companies and government authorities to eliminate the remaining card points and to use the points to provide more services and benefits to the customers than the competition card companies. It shows that they are looking for a place to use.

Now, referring to FIG. 3, a method of operating an integrated point service using a card point according to the present invention will be described.
First, when the user uses the card, the
Then, when the user requests exchange of the card point to the integration point using the
Then, when the user requests purchase of an item through the integrated point exchanged from the card point by using the
At this time, the integration
Finally, the integration
At this time, the settlement rate (for example, 60%) of the aggregate point service fiduciary is set to be relatively lower than the settlement rate of the credit card company (for example, 70%). The integration point operator generates profits by covering operating expenses through the difference of these settlement rates.
In this way, by utilizing card points that occur as a user uses a credit card, he or she can induce the user to use goods or services including games to activate the market of games and the like, thereby creating synergy between integrated point operators, credit card companies, To maximize profit creation.
